Why Choose High-Dose Melatonin?

Understanding Melatonin’s Role in Your Body

Melatonin is a hormone naturally produced by your pineal gland, playing a crucial role in regulating sleep-wake cycles and optimizing overall health. Often referred to as the "sleep hormone," melatonin influences various physiological processes, including:

  • Sleep Quality: It promotes deeper, more restorative sleep.
  • Circadian Rhythm: Melatonin helps maintain a healthy 24-hour cycle.
  • Immune Function: This hormone supports a robust immune system.
  • Antioxidant Properties: Offers protection against oxidative stress.

High-Dose Melatonin Safety and Considerations

Proper Dosage and Administration

To ensure safety and effectiveness, it’s crucial to understand proper dosage and administration:

  • Consult a Healthcare Professional: Before taking high-dose melatonin, consult your doctor, especially if you have any underlying health conditions or are taking other medications.
  • Dosage Variability: The recommended dosage varies based on the purpose of supplementation. Typically, doses range from 1 to 20 mg for sleep-related issues.
  • Timing is Key: Take melatonin supplements at the appropriate time to align with your desired sleep schedule. For jet lag, take it when you would normally wake up at your destination.
  • Consistency: Maintain consistency in taking your melatonin supplement daily for best results.

Potential Side Effects and Precautions

While generally safe when used appropriately, high-dose melatonin may cause mild side effects:

  • Gastrointestinal Issues: Some individuals might experience nausea, vomiting, or stomach discomfort.
  • Headache: Mild headaches are a possible temporary side effect.
  • Daytime Sleepiness: In rare cases, it can cause excessive sleepiness during the day.
  • Hormonal Impact: High doses may temporarily affect hormone levels, especially in individuals with underlying hormonal disorders.
  • Drug Interactions: Melatonin can interact with certain medications, so inform your doctor if you’re taking any other drugs.

Who Should Avoid High-Dose Melatonin?

The following groups should exercise caution or avoid high-dose melatonin supplements:

  • Pregnant or Breastfeeding Women: There’s limited research on the effects of melatonin during pregnancy and breastfeeding, so it’s best to avoid until more data is available.
  • Individuals with Hormonal Disorders: People with conditions like thyroid disorders or Cushing’s syndrome should consult their doctor before taking melatonin due to potential hormonal interactions.
  • Children: Melatonin supplements are generally not recommended for children unless under medical supervision.
  • People with Certain Medical Conditions: Individuals with severe depression, seizure disorders, or diabetes should consult their healthcare provider before using high-dose melatonin.
